Strategic focus on AI and software
Zebra Technologies highlights intelligent automation, real-time visibility and analytics as central pillars of its multi-year strategic plan for supply chain and retail customers, according to its latest corporate overview on the investor site. The company stresses that software and subscription-based services are gaining importance alongside traditional hardware such as scanners and mobile computers.
Management also underscores that AI-enabled workflows and computer vision are increasingly embedded in warehouse, retail and healthcare solutions to improve productivity and reduce errors, building on prior acquisitions in areas such as robotics and workflow optimization.

How Zebra Technologies makes money
Zebra Technologies generates revenue primarily from enterprise-grade mobile computers, barcode scanners, RFID readers, printers and related software platforms that serve logistics, retail, manufacturing and healthcare workflows. A representative product line is its rugged enterprise mobile computers, which combine scanning, wireless connectivity and tailored software to support inventory and order management.
